CC -!- FUNCTION: Receptor for glutamate that functions as a ligand-gated ion
CC channel in the central nervous system and plays an important role in
CC excitatory synaptic transmission. L-glutamate acts as an excitatory
CC neurotransmitter at many synapses in the central nervous system.
CC {ECO:0000256|RuleBase:RU367118}.
CC -!- SUBCELLULAR LOCATION: Cell membrane {ECO:0000256|RuleBase:RU367118};
CC Multi-pass membrane protein {ECO:0000256|RuleBase:RU367118}.
CC Postsynaptic cell membrane {ECO:0000256|RuleBase:RU367118}. Membrane
CC {ECO:0000256|ARBA:ARBA00004141}; Multi-pass membrane protein
CC {ECO:0000256|ARBA:ARBA00004141}.
CC -!- SIMILARITY: Belongs to the glutamate-gated ion channel (TC 1.A.10.1)
CC family. {ECO:0000256|RuleBase:RU367118}.
